Skip to content

Commit 16d4bd4

Browse files
lianchengrxin
authored andcommitted
[SPARK-18730] Post Jenkins test report page instead of the full console output page to GitHub
## What changes were proposed in this pull request? Currently, the full console output page of a Spark Jenkins PR build can be as large as several megabytes. It takes a relatively long time to load and may even freeze the browser for quite a while. This PR makes the build script to post the test report page link to GitHub instead. The test report page is way more concise and is usually the first page I'd like to check when investigating a Jenkins build failure. Note that for builds that a test report is not available (ongoing builds and builds that fail before test execution), the test report link automatically redirects to the build page. ## How was this patch tested? N/A. Author: Cheng Lian <lian@databricks.com> Closes #16163 from liancheng/jenkins-test-report. (cherry picked from commit ba4aab9b85688141d3d0c185165ec7a402c9fbba) Signed-off-by: Reynold Xin <rxin@databricks.com>
1 parent f999312 commit 16d4bd4

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

dev/run-tests-jenkins.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-80,7 +80,7 @@ def pr_message(build_display_name,
8080
short_commit_hash,
8181
commit_url,
8282
str(' ' + post_msg + '.') if post_msg else '.')
83-
return '**[Test build %s %s](%sconsoleFull)** for PR %s at commit [`%s`](%s)%s' % str_args
83+
return '**[Test build %s %s](%stestReport)** for PR %s at commit [`%s`](%s)%s' % str_args
8484

8585

8686
def run_pr_checks(pr_tests, ghprb_actual_commit, sha1):

0 commit comments

Comments
 (0)